Put a spin on a Thanksgiving classic with this sweet potato bake. This festive-looking side captures the flavors of sweet potatoes, marshmallows and tart cranberries! —Delores Nickerson, Muskogee, Oklahoma

Nutritional Facts 2/3 cup equals 179 calories, 5 g fat (2 g saturated fat), 8 mg cholesterol, 187 mg sodium, 32 g carbohydrate, 3 g fiber, 2 g protein. Diabetic Exchanges: 2 starch, 1 fat.
